Batman Arkham Series Developer Rocksteady Studios is Working On a New Game Starring the Dark Knight – Rumor

Batman Arkham series developer Rocksteady Studios is working on a new game starring the Dark Knight, according to rumors circulating online.

Earlier today, XboxEra's Shpeshal Nick said on X that he had heard that Rocksteady Studios was working specifically on a new Batman game, not a remaster or remake of previous entries in the series. Apparently, Sony is also trying to money-hat the game, so it may end up being a PlayStation console exclusive.

Given how Rocksteady Studios' latest project, Suicide Squad: Kill the Justice League, failed by all metrics, it makes sense for the studio to go back to the character that propelled the studio among the most respected development studios ever. Still, without an official confirmation, which may not be coming for some time, we have to take this reveal with a huge grain of salt.

The latest entry in Rocksteady Studios' popular series is Batman Arkham Knight, which introduced a much bigger map than its predecessor, and the Batmobile, which ended up being one of the game's most important features. Last year, the game was ported to Nintendo Switch with some baffling results, as the game ran at a staggering 0 frames per second in certain scenarios at launch. The game is also well-remembered by the PC community due to its horrible port, which required plenty of time and work to get fixed.
